From 9ebc0aa1dc528c28bd9dd8cdaf1f54fcf837f1e0 Mon Sep 17 00:00:00 2001 From: Jasder <2053003901@@qq.com> Date: Tue, 22 Sep 2020 16:15:30 +0800 Subject: [PATCH] ADD rails log --- app/controllers/concerns/ci/db_connectable.rb |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/app/controllers/concerns/ci/db_connectable.rb b/app/controllers/concerns/ci/db_connectable.rb index 228221b3e..23113aa26 100644 --- a/app/controllers/concerns/ci/db_connectable.rb +++ b/app/controllers/concerns/ci/db_connectable.rb @@ -24,14 +24,17 @@ module Ci::DbConnectable end def auto_create_database!(connection, database) - connection.execute("CREATE DATABASE #{database}") + Rails.logger.info "[CI::DbConnectable] auto_create_database's connection: #{connection}" + connection.execute("CREATE DATABASE IF NOT EXISTS #{database}") end def auto_create_table_structure!(connection) + Rails.logger.info "[CI::DbConnectable] auto_create_table_structure's connection: #{connection}" # Ci::Schema.execute(username, password, port, host, database) # con_result = @connection.execute(Ci::Schema.statement) Ci::Schema.statement.split(';').map(&:strip).each do |sql| + Rails.logger.info "[CI::DbConnectable] auto_create_table_structure's sql: #{sql}" con_result = connection.execute(sql) Rails.logger.info "=============> ci create tabels result: #{con_result}" end